Anyway, I am tossing around the idea of getting some Silkies (just 2) but I also have an order coming in June of 2 BO's, 1 EE and 1 Light Brahma... being that Silkies are so much smaller, will this be a problem? Would I be able to move the Silkies to the coop (when the newbies come) and then move the other batch out 4 or 5 weeks later? Should I keep the Silkies in the brooder with the babies for awhile? Is there any way to make this thing work? Any advise would be SO appreciated.
i have no real experience here... but I would say it will be fine. I have silkies mixed w/ other bantams and some LF. They are so much smaller, i dont think it will hurt them to be in the brood box a bit longer w/ the other chicks. and we added 2 more chicks about a 1.5wks later to the orginal batch (Marans) and they were fine. actually one of my silkies is still so small, we are going to have to keep her in longer than the rest of ehr flock. So we decided the other 10 birds will go out this week, and the one tiny Silkie and one of our LF Cochins will stay in until the Silkie is bigger....
